Celebrate the magic and wonder of Harry Potter with free events for all ages this January at the Anderson County Library System. Harry Potter books and movies have been delighting children and adults since Harry Potter and the Philosopher’s Stone was first published in 1997. “The world of Harry Potter is magical and resonates with people of all ages,” says Teen Librarian Miriam Church. “I love the Harry Potter series, which made planning these programs fun for me!” Children and teens can register for a tee time at the Powdersville Library for Hogwarts: A Hole in One on Friday, January 3 from 2:00-4:00 pm. The indoor miniature golf will have kids play putt-putt through Platform 9 ¾, Diagon Alley, Hogwarts, and more. Children will also be able to participate in a Triwizard Scavenger Hunt at 4pm on January 7 at the Belton Library, January 14 at the Lander Memorial Library, and January 28 at the Anderson Main Library. Teens can participate in an interactive screening of Harry Potter and the Sorcerer’s Stone on Monday, January 17 at 5:00 pm at the Pendleton Library.
